What is Every(Body) Wants To Be A Showgirl?
The Largest Global Celebration of Black Burlesque Artists
Curated by international burlesque icon, Aquarius Moon, Every(body) Wants to Be a Showgirl is a traveling exhibition celebrating the artistry, cultural impact, and living legacy of Black burlesque performers. Featuring over 100 Black performers from around the world, the exhibition centers living artists while honoring the lineage of Black performance traditions. Black burlesque has long been a site of innovation, resistance, and economic impact, yet its contributions remain under-documented and underfunded. This exhibition is a corrective initiative—creating visibility, care, and historical context while supporting artists who are actively sustaining the art form.The project is Black-led, community-informed, and ethically curated, prioritizing dignity, authorship, and legacy over extraction. This exhibit is 100% self funded and independently produced.
